Sarah Hagen – Wonder Women! A Celebration for Female Composers

Washington Center Black Box 512 Washington St SE, Olympia, WA

In “Wonder Women!”, pianist and humorist Sarah Hagen delves into the remarkable stories and piano music of forgotten female composers from the classical repertoire. This recital will highlight piano works by 18th and 19th century composers, including Clara Schumann, Cécile Chaminade, Delphine von Schauroth, and others.
